Scaffolding CS for ELs K-5

December 12, 2025

4:00 PM – 6:00 PM

Virtual workshop

Join this session to discover how scaffolding CS learning increases accessibility for English Learners. We will model how to identify computer science (CS) and computational thinking (CT) concepts, practices, and skills within non-CS subject areas. Then, we will practice various evidence-based pedagogical approaches that support opportunities to meaningfully engage English Learners in grade-level CS learning, as well as increase skills in language development and executive functioning.

Presenter: Charity Freeman

Scaffolding CS for ELs for 6-12

January 15, 2026

4:00 PM – 6:00 PM

Virtual workshop

6-12 Educators: Join this session to learn how to integrate computer science (CS) concepts and computational thinking (CT) practices into multiple subjects for English Learners. We will analyze various curricular resources and instructional materials that are aligned to WIDA and CS standards. Then, we will develop lessons and activities that provide English Learners with multiple opportunities (in a year and across grade levels) to apply CS/CT concepts and practices to other content areas.

Presenter: Charity Freeman

Cyber for ELs

April 21, 2026

4:00 PM – 6:00 PM

Virtual workshop

Join this session to learn how to address and overcome challenges to integrating cybersecurity concepts and practices into instruction of English Learners. We will discuss why cyber knowledge and digital citizenship are essential for English Learners and explore various career opportunities afforded by quality cyber education. Then, we will scaffold CYBER.ORG curricular lessons and instructional activities for English Learners to help them enhance language skill development, as well as connect and apply cyber knowledge to their home lives.

Presenter: Charity Freeman

AI for ELs

May 21, 2026

4:00 PM – 6:00 PM

Virtual workshop

Join this session to learn how to incorporate artificial intelligence (AI) tools and concepts into multiple subject areas (e.g., math, science, and writing), while supporting English Learners in language skill development. We will evaluate and utilize curated AI tools and curricular resources to create and/or modify lessons, activities, and instructional materials that support differentiated instruction of English Learners. Then, we will discuss strategies for helping English Learners understand the impact of AI in their everyday lives.

Presenter: Charity Freeman
